반응형

2020/05 835

iPad / iPhone에서 CSS 제출 버튼 이상한 렌더링

iPad / iPhone에서 CSS 제출 버튼 이상한 렌더링 반경, 색상 및 테두리를 사용하여 CSS로 버튼의 스타일을 지정하면 모양이 좋지만 iphone / ipad / ipod에서는 끔찍한 것처럼 보입니다 ... Safari Desktop과 동일한 렌더링이 아니어야합니까 ?? 죄송합니다! 방금 나 자신을 찾았습니다 : 필요한 요소 에이 줄을 추가하십시오. -webkit-appearance: none; 이 코드를 CSS 파일에 추가하십시오. input { -webkit-appearance: none; -moz-appearance: none; appearance: none; } 도움이 될 것입니다. 웹킷 모양에 대한 위의 답변은 마술을 수행했지만 버튼은 다른 장치 / 데스크탑의 브라우저와 비교할 때 여전..

Programing 2020.05.06

.join () 메소드는 정확히 무엇을합니까?

.join () 메소드는 정확히 무엇을합니까? 나는 파이썬을 처음 접했고 .join()문자열을 연결하는 데 선호되는 방법이라는 것을 완전히 혼동했습니다 . 나는 시도했다 : strid = repr(595) print array.array('c', random.sample(string.ascii_letters, 20 - len(strid))) .tostring().join(strid) 다음과 같은 것을 얻었습니다. 5wlfgALGbXOahekxSs9wlfgALGbXOahekxSs5 왜 이렇게 작동합니까? 안 595만 자동으로 추가 할 수? 출력을주의 깊게 살펴보십시오. 5wlfgALGbXOahekxSs9wlfgALGbXOahekxSs5 ^ ^ ^ 원래 문자열의 "5", "9", "5"를 강조 표시했습니다...

Programing 2020.05.06

스칼라에서 목록의 끝에 요소 추가

스칼라에서 목록의 끝에 요소 추가 어리석은 질문처럼 들리지만 인터넷에서 찾은 것은 쓰레기였습니다. 단순히 type 요소를 Tlist에 추가 할 수 없습니다 List[T]. 나는 시도 myList ::= myElement했지만 이상한 객체를 만들고 액세스하면 myList.last항상 목록에 넣은 첫 번째 요소를 반환하는 것 같습니다 . List(1,2,3) :+ 4 Results in List[Int] = List(1, 2, 3, 4) 이 연산의 복잡성은 O (n)입니다. 이 작업이 자주 필요하거나 긴 목록의 경우 다른 데이터 형식 (예 : ListBuffer)을 사용하는 것이 좋습니다. 최소한 불변 목록을 사용해서는 안되기 때문입니다. 실제로 데이터 구조의 끝에 요소를 추가해야 하고이 데이터 구조가 실제..

Programing 2020.05.06

파이프와 함께 서브 프로세스 명령을 사용하는 방법

파이프와 함께 서브 프로세스 명령을 사용하는 방법 subprocess.check_output()와 함께 사용하고 싶습니다 ps -A | grep 'process_name'. 다양한 솔루션을 시도했지만 지금까지 아무것도 효과가 없었습니다. 누군가 나를 어떻게 도울 수 있습니까? subprocess모듈 과 함께 파이프를 사용하려면 을 통과해야 shell=True합니다. 그러나 이것은 여러 가지 이유로 실제로 권장되지는 않지만 보안은 최소한입니다. 대신 ps및 grep프로세스를 별도로 작성하고 다음 과 같이 출력을 서로 연결하십시오. ps = subprocess.Popen(('ps', '-A'), stdout=subprocess.PIPE) output = subprocess.check_output(('grep..

Programing 2020.05.06

jQuery를 사용하여 테이블 셀 값을 얻는 방법은 무엇입니까?

jQuery를 사용하여 테이블 셀 값을 얻는 방법은 무엇입니까? jQuery를 사용하여 각 행의 테이블 셀 값을 얻는 방법을 연구 중입니다. 내 테이블은 다음과 같습니다 Customer Id Result 123 456 789 기본적으로 테이블을 반복 Customer Id하고 각 행 의 열 값을 가져 옵니다. 아래 코드에서 각 행을 반복하기 위해이 작업을 수행해야한다는 것을 알았지 만 행의 첫 번째 셀 값을 얻는 방법을 잘 모르겠습니다. $('#mytable tr').each(function() { var cutomerId = } 가능하면 고객 ID가 포함 된 TD에서 클래스 속성을 사용하여 다음과 같이 작성할 수 있습니다. $('#mytable tr').each(function() { var custom..

Programing 2020.05.06

도커 컨테이너에서 호스트 포트에 액세스하는 방법

도커 컨테이너에서 호스트 포트에 액세스하는 방법 jenkins를 실행하는 도커 컨테이너가 있습니다. 빌드 프로세스의 일부로 호스트 시스템에서 로컬로 실행되는 웹 서버에 액세스해야합니다. 호스트 웹 서버 (포트에서 실행되도록 구성 할 수있는)가 jenkins 컨테이너에 노출 될 수있는 방법이 있습니까? 편집 : Linux 시스템에서 기본적으로 docker를 실행하고 있습니다. 최신 정보: 아래 @larsks 응답 외에도 호스트 컴퓨터에서 호스트 IP의 IP 주소를 얻으려면 다음을 수행하십시오. ip addr show docker0 | grep -Po 'inet \K[\d.]+' Linux에서 Docker를 기본적으로 실행하는 경우 docker0인터페이스 의 IP 주소를 사용하여 호스트 서비스에 액세스 할 ..

Programing 2020.05.06

동적 프로그래밍을 사용하여 가장 긴 하위 시퀀스를 결정하는 방법은 무엇입니까?

동적 프로그래밍을 사용하여 가장 긴 하위 시퀀스를 결정하는 방법은 무엇입니까? 정수 세트가 있습니다. 동적 프로그래밍을 사용하여 해당 세트 의 가장 긴 하위 시퀀스 를 찾고 싶습니다 . 먼저 가장 간단한 솔루션 인 O (N ^ 2)를 설명하겠습니다. 여기서 N은 컬렉션의 크기입니다. O (N log N) 솔루션도 있는데, 이것도 설명하겠습니다. 봐 여기 섹션 효율적인 알고리즘에 그것을합니다. 배열의 인덱스가 0에서 N-1 사이라고 가정하겠습니다. 따라서 DP[i]index가있는 element에서 끝나는 LIS (Longest 증가하는 서브 시퀀스)의 길이로 정의하겠습니다 i. 계산하기 위해 DP[i]우리는 모든 지수를보고 j DP[i]그리고 array[j] < ..

Programing 2020.05.06

sh에서 'find'의 '-prune'옵션을 사용하는 방법은 무엇입니까?

sh에서 'find'의 '-prune'옵션을 사용하는 방법은 무엇입니까? 나는에서 주어진 예를 이해하지 못합니다. man find누구든지 나에게 몇 가지 예와 설명을 줄 수 있습니까? 정규 표현식을 결합 할 수 있습니까? 더 자세한 질문은 다음과 같습니다. changeall와 같은 인터페이스를 가진 쉘 스크립트를 작성하십시오 changeall [-r|-R] "string1" "string2". 그것은의 접미사로 모든 파일을 찾을 것입니다 .h, .C, .cc, 또는 .cpp모든 항목 변경 string1에를 string2. -r현재 디렉토리에만 머 무르거나 하위 디렉토리를 포함하는 옵션입니다. 노트: 재귀 ls가 아닌 경우 허용되지 않으며 find및 만 사용할 수 있습니다 sed. 시도 find -dept..

Programing 2020.05.06

String, StringBuffer 및 StringBuilder

String, StringBuffer 및 StringBuilder 비교 나에게 실시간으로 상황을 알려주십시오 String, StringBuffer그리고 StringBuilder? 돌연변이 차이 : String이다 불변 당신이 그 값을 변경하려고하면, 또 다른 목적은 반면, 작성되는, StringBuffer그리고 StringBuilder있습니다 가변 그들의 값을 변경할 수 있습니다. 스레드 안전성 차이 : 의 차이 StringBuffer와는 StringBuilder즉 StringBuffer스레드 안전합니다. 따라서 응용 프로그램을 단일 스레드에서만 실행해야하는 경우 사용하는 것이 좋습니다 StringBuilder. StringBuilder보다 효율적 StringBuffer입니다. 상황 : 문자열이 변경되지..

Programing 2020.05.06

gradle 의존성이 새로운 버전인지 확인하는 방법

gradle 의존성이 새로운 버전인지 확인하는 방법 Android Studio +에서 (와 같은 com.android.support:recyclerview-v7:21.+) 버전 번호를 사용할 때 "버전 번호에 +를 사용하지 마십시오"경고가 표시됩니다. 특정 버전 번호를 사용하면 항상 최신 버전을 사용할 수 없습니다. 내 프로젝트에 많은 의존성이 있습니다. 종속성에 최신 버전이 있는지 어떻게 확인합니까? 새로운 버전의 종속성이있을 때 알려주는 Android Studio 플러그인이 있습니까? 편집 : Android 스튜디오는 오래된 Android 지원 라이브러리 및 Google Play 서비스를 강조 표시합니다. 그러나 다른 사용자 정의 라이브러리에는 사용할 수 없습니다. 이제 Lint 점검으로 Androi..

Programing 2020.05.06
반응형